About

The purpose of this study is to test whether ultrasound images (pictures) can be used as a valid assessment of muscle quality in different muscle groups during Intensive Care stay. This new approach would allow clinicians to obtain frequent skeletal muscle images and would enable doctors to observe any changes over time in muscle quality that could occur during ICU stay.

Participants in this study will have ultrasound images made of their leg-, chest- and jaw muscles taken on every day until ICU discharge.
